WebJul 25, 2024 · Generally, TPD payouts won’t impact your centrelink payments, particularly if that payout is held within super. However a TPD payout is a form of income and you should always report any changes in circumstances to centrelink. It pays a monthly benefit (maybe up to 85% of your … WebIncome protection offset clauses Some (but not all) income protection insurance policies offset Centrelink payments. This means that if you are receiving Centrelink payments, your income protection payments will either be reduced dollar-for-dollar by those Centrelink payments or income protection will only top up your Centrelink payments.
